Attractive 1892-CC Double Eagle, MS61

1892-CC $20 MS61 NGC. While the 1892-CC is no longer considered to be as rare as once believed, it remains scarce, especially in high grades, with a mintage of just 27,265 pieces. This example is exceptionally sharp at the centers, and only a couple of stars show minor weakness. A number of light grazes define the grade, but they barely affect the eye-catching reflectivity. NGC has certified only 41 pieces finer (8/08).
